#1db7b8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1db7b8 is composed of 11.4% red, 71.8%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.2% cyan, 0.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 180.4 degrees, a saturation of 72.8% and a lightness of 41.8%. #1db7b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#3affff with #006f71.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#1db7b8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020e0f is the darkest color, while #fdffff is the lightest one.
